Ariel, I have the Energy TAKE series in a 6.1 set up using the LCRs as the center and Front/Right and Left and the SATs for the Left/Right and Back surrounds.

I don't have the Energy sub, instead using a Velodyne DLS 3750, also a 10".

For my ears this is a very good value. If you have just a couple of extra $$$ I suggest you consider the LCRs for the fronts instead of the SATs. they both require stands so the footprint will be the same and the LCRs provide a fuller sound with (2) 3 1/2 woofers vs the (1) on the SAT.

Also, for bass management I found it best to set the sub crossover at 100db as the rolloff on the LCRs is 75 and the SAT is at 80.

All in all, with a good sub, they produce a very clean and rich environment,


I have not heard the others you listed, but if you decide on the Energy's I think you will be happy. good luck and enjoy the hunt
